By: dkozin,
in Electronics
,
Oct 26, 2007
Pros: Price, image stabilization, features and performance, 4x zoom, face recognition
Cons: Soft corners and chromatic aberrations at wide angle, no wide angle, red eye
Bottom Line: I like the Canon SD850 IS overall. It has its issues with soft corners of the frame and chromatic aberrations, but it is a very good camera overall...
